Lemurs (from Latin lemures – ghosts or spirits) are wet-nosed primates of the superfamily Lemuroidea (/lɛmjʊˈrɔɪdiə/), divided into 8 families and consisting of 15 genera and around 100 existing species. They are endemic to the island of Madagascar.
